Turim 21 Investimentos Ltda. bought a new stake in NexGen Energy (NYSE:NXE - Free Report) during the 2nd qu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or bought 174,032 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$1,634,000. NexGen Energy accounts for about 0.3% of Turim 21 Investimentos Ltda.'s portfolio, making the stock its 21st biggest position.

NexGen Energy Stock Performance

Shares of NXE opened at $10.53 on Thursday. The stock has a 50-day moving average of $9.77 and a two-hundred day moving average of $11.09. The stock has a market cap of $7.05 billion, a P/E ratio of -26.33 and a beta of 1.40. NexGen Energy has a one year low of $6.26 and a one year high of $13.96.

About NexGen Energy

(Free Report)

NexGen Energy is a Canada-based uranium exploration and development company focused on advancing its flagship Rook I project in the Athabasca Basin of northern Saskatchewan. The company's primary activities include resource delineation, feasibility studies, and permitting for its high-grade Arrow deposit, one of the largest undeveloped uranium discoveries in the region. NexGen's technical team employs advanced drilling, geophysical and geochemical techniques to expand and define its resource base, with the aim of delivering a robust, low-cost supply of uranium to global nuclear power markets.

The Rook I project sits within one of the world's most prolific uranium districts, offering excellent infrastructure access, a skilled local workforce and a supportive regulatory regime.
